> I know this isn't exactly a Daisy question, but I could really use some
> help. This is a custom document style for generating books:
> 
> <?xml version="1.0"?>
> <xsl:stylesheet version="1.0"
> xmlns:xsl="http://www.w3.org/1999/XSL/Transform"
>   xmlns:d="http://outerx.org/daisy/1.0"
>   xmlns:einclude="http://outerx.org/daisy/1.0#externalinclude"
>   xmlns:i18n="http://apache.org/cocoon/i18n/2.1"
>   xmlns:p="http://outerx.org/daisy/1.0#publisher">
> 
> 	<!-- for some reason relative paths don't work here... -->
> 	<xsl:import
> href="file:/C:/daisy-2.0/WikiData/books/publicationtypes/common/book-
> documen
> t-to-html.xsl" />
> 
> 	<xsl:template match="d:part[@name='Requirements']/html/body">
> 		<h2 class="requirements">Requirements</h2>
> 		<xsl:value-of select="."/>
> 	</xsl:template>
> 
> 	<xsl:template
> match="d:part[@name='SimpleDocumentContent']/html/body">
> 		<h2>Procedure</h2>
> 		<xsl:value-of select="."/>
> 	</xsl:template>
> 
> </xsl:stylesheet>
> 
> The headers are not making it to the book, and I dunno why. Any
> thoughts?
> 
> Thanks much,
> Caleb
> 

And you did try with wikidata:books before? Like so:

<xsl:import
href="wikidata:books/publicationtypes/common/book-document-to-html.xsl" />
